Definitions:

Efficiency

Efficiency in economics means the optimal allocation of scarce resources to meet the desired objectives, minimizing waste and maximizing value.

Economy

A broad term that encompasses all activities related to the production, consumption, and trade of goods and services in an area or country.

Partial Equilibrium

A concept in economic analysis that examines the equilibrium condition in a single market or sector without considering interactions with other markets or sectors.

Technological Advance

The improvement or development of new methods, devices, or materials that increase efficiency and productivity.
